Belt Tension
The sanding belt tension for your Model W1688
Edge Sander has been setup at the factory; how-
ever, due to shipping, varying belt length, or
long use of the sander, the tension may need to
be adjusted. You can compensate for this nor-
mal condition by adjusting the hex bolt on the
end of the tension rod to increase or decrease
the belt tension. See Figure 35.
To adjust the belt tension, do these steps:
1. Unplug the edge sander.
2. Turn the 1"-8 hex nut on the end of the ten-
sion rod counterclockwise to increase the
belt tension, or turn it clockwise to decrease
the belt tension. See Figure 35. The tension
must hold the belt firmly without belt slap on
the platen or skidding on the rollers during
sanding operations.
Keep your machine
unplugged during all
assembly, adjustments,
or maintenance proce-
dures. Otherwise serious
personal injury may
occur!
DO NOT unthread the nut to expose the
internal threads of the nut. The nut may
rattle off as a result, and jam the machine
causing machine damage and personal
injury!
